DDD
浏览量2977    |    粉丝2    |    关注4
  • 霞舞

    霞舞

    2025-11-29 17:35:02
    在Java应用中导出MySQL表为SQL文件:实用教程
    本教程详细介绍了如何在Java应用程序中将MySQL数据库表导出为SQL文件。主要方法是利用mysqldump命令行工具,通过Java的Runtime.exec()方法执行系统命令。文章还探讨了通过JDBC编程手动构建SQL插入语句的替代方案,并提供了相应的Java代码示例、注意事项及安全建议,旨在为开发者提供一套完整的解决方案。
    537
  • 霞舞

    霞舞

    2025-11-29 17:36:02
    如何实现二叉树的左到右平衡插入
    本文深入探讨了如何在非二叉搜索树(BST)场景下,实现一个满足左到右填充且保持平衡的二叉树插入功能。文章首先阐明了与传统BST插入的区别,随后详细介绍了利用树的当前节点总数(size)的二进制表示来精确导航至下一个插入点的核心策略。通过提供一个高效的迭代式Java实现,文章演示了如何根据二进制位路径遍历树,并在正确位置添加新节点,最终构建出一个结构规整的完全二叉树。
    220
  • 碧海醫心

    碧海醫心

    2025-11-29 17:41:02
    Go语言中JSON数组反序列化:常见问题与解决方案
    本文深入探讨Go语言中进行JSON反序列化时常遇到的问题,特别是针对JSON数组的处理。内容涵盖了错误处理的重要性、JSON语法校验、以及如何正确匹配JSON数据结构与Go类型。通过具体的代码示例,帮助开发者理解并规避反序列化过程中的常见陷阱,确保数据转换的准确性和程序的健壮性。
    504
  • 聖光之護

    聖光之護

    2025-11-29 17:46:01
    如何在CSS中设置背景图片:全面教程与最佳实践
    本教程详细介绍了如何在CSS中使用background-image属性为网页元素添加背景图片。文章将涵盖基本语法、图片路径类型、实用示例代码,并深入探讨background-repeat、background-position、background-size等进阶控制属性,旨在帮助读者掌握背景图片的灵活应用与性能优化技巧。
    1041
  • 心靈之曲

    心靈之曲

    2025-11-29 17:46:20
    如何正确单元测试异常捕获块中的适配器模式
    本文旨在指导开发者如何有效地单元测试Java中包含异常捕获块(catch)和异常适配器(ExceptionAdapter)的代码。我们将深入探讨在模拟(mocking)异常适配器行为时常见的误区,特别是区分方法是抛出异常还是返回异常对象,并提供正确的测试策略和代码示例,确保异常处理逻辑得到充分覆盖和验证。
    752
  • 碧海醫心

    碧海醫心

    2025-11-29 17:48:02
    在Go语言中直接从标准输入扫描 big.Int
    Go语言的fmt.Scan函数能够直接将标准输入中的大整数扫描并解析到*big.Int类型变量中,无需中间字符串转换。这简化了对任意精度整数的处理流程,提高了代码的简洁性和效率,尤其适用于需要处理超出原生整型范围数值的场景。
    267
  • 霞舞

    霞舞

    2025-11-29 17:51:03
    Java方法中String变量的返回与字符串比较陷阱
    本文深入探讨了Java方法中处理String类型变量返回和字符串内容比较时常见的两个陷阱。首先,解释了Java编译器如何严格检查所有代码路径是否都能到达return语句,并提供了正确的变量初始化和返回策略。其次,详细阐述了==运算符与equals()方法在字符串比较上的本质区别,并推荐使用isEmpty()方法进行空字符串判断,以避免常见的逻辑错误和潜在的运行时问题。通过示例代码,本文旨在帮助开发者编写更健壮、更符合Java规范的代码。
    303
  • 心靈之曲

    心靈之曲

    2025-11-29 17:54:00
    Go Template 中如何优雅地判断循环中的最后一个元素
    本文将详细介绍在Go语言模板(text/template)中如何识别range循环中的最后一个元素。通过注册自定义模板函数,结合reflect包或Go内置的len函数,我们可以实现在输出时对末尾元素进行特殊格式化,例如添加连接词“and”,从而生成更自然流畅的文本列表。
    989
  • 花韻仙語

    花韻仙語

    2025-11-29 18:01:42
    Go语言中大容量缓冲通道的内存开销与最佳实践
    Go语言中的缓冲通道在创建时会立即分配其指定容量所需的全部内存。这意味着,如果通道容量设置得过大,即使没有数据写入,也会导致显著的内存预分配,可能造成不必要的资源浪费和潜在的性能问题。因此,在设计系统时,应仔细评估通道的实际需求,并在需要超大缓冲区时考虑其他数据结构。
    520
  • 聖光之護

    聖光之護

    2025-11-29 18:21:00
    Java方法返回路径与字符串比较陷阱解析
    本文深入探讨Java方法中return语句的编译时路径保证,以及字符串比较时==与.equals()(或.isEmpty())的正确用法。通过实例代码,解析编译器如何评估代码可达性,并纠正常见的字符串判空错误,旨在帮助开发者编写更健壮、无编译问题的Java代码。
    996

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号